獲取 mongo 鏡像
sudo docker pull mongo
運(yùn)行 mongodb 服務(wù)
sudo docker run -p 27017:27017 -v /tmp/db:/data/db -d mongo
運(yùn)行 mongodb 客戶端
使用 mongo-express 管理mongodb
mongo-express是MongoDB的一個(gè)可視化圖形管理工具,這里我們還是通過(guò)docker來(lái)運(yùn)行一個(gè)mongo-express,來(lái)管理上面創(chuàng)建的mongodb服務(wù)。
下載 mongo-express 鏡像
sudo docker pull docker.io/mongo-express
啟動(dòng) mongo-express 服務(wù)
sudo docker run -it --rm -p 8081:8081 --link <mongoDB容器ID>:mongo mongo-express
訪問 mongo-express
通過(guò)瀏覽器訪問
http://<宿主機(jī)IP地址>:8081
使用 mongoclient 管理 mongodb
下載 mongoclient 鏡像
sudo docker pull mongoclient/mongoclient
啟動(dòng) mongoclient 服務(wù)
訪問 mongoclient
通過(guò)瀏覽器訪問
http://<宿主機(jī)IP地址>:3000
以上就是本文的全部?jī)?nèi)容,希望對(duì)大家的學(xué)習(xí)有所幫助,也希望大家多多支持腳本之家。
標(biāo)簽:開封 張家口 珠海 襄陽(yáng) 巴中 湘潭 阜陽(yáng) 西藏
巨人網(wǎng)絡(luò)通訊聲明:本文標(biāo)題《在Docker中使用mongodb數(shù)據(jù)庫(kù)的實(shí)現(xiàn)代碼》,本文關(guān)鍵詞 在,Docker,中,使用,mongodb,;如發(fā)現(xiàn)本文內(nèi)容存在版權(quán)問題,煩請(qǐng)?zhí)峁┫嚓P(guān)信息告之我們,我們將及時(shí)溝通與處理。本站內(nèi)容系統(tǒng)采集于網(wǎng)絡(luò),涉及言論、版權(quán)與本站無(wú)關(guān)。